Verification of subsurface conditions at selected ''rock'' accelerograph stations in California. Volume 2

This report investigates the subsurface soil conditions at accelerograph stations which have been categorized by other researchers as ''rock'' sites. Contained in this volume are findings of the site conditions at 29 accelerograph stations in California. Subsurface conditions at the sites were investigated with a geologic reconnaissance and a review of available boring data. At three sites, where boring data was not available, a test hole was drilled to better define the depth to rock. Of the 29 ''rock'' sites that were investigated, less than half could be verified as being founded on or within about 20 feet of rock. This would imply that over half of the stations are really soil sites.
